Forgive my imprecision, but QT is apparently the media engine beneath iTunes. QT will playback protected video/audio so long as the computer has been authorized via iTunes. This should not be a TOS violation.

I noticed that SongBird will use QT to playback pAAC files, which is great if you wish to use SongBird. I've found it to be seamless.

I'm wondering if there's an equivalent way to get VLC to playback protected video files via QT. I've got everything else in VLC working great.
